Checklist item 14: Static-analysis baseline file integrity. Confirm that the Lintmere baseline file in the Harborline repo has not been modified outside an approved suppression review. Compare the current checksum against the last signed audit snapshot, verify that every new suppression entry references a tracked ticket, and ensure no wildcard rules were added. If any discrepancy is found, freeze merges to the main branch and open an incident note. Any deviation must be escalated directly to the baseline steward listed below.

account owner for bawip-tahag: Raleth Quenok

- [ ] Before the Quorumvale key ceremony proceeds, confirm that request tracing is verified end-to-end across the Lattermill microservices: spans must propagate through the gateway, the ledger service, and the notifier without orphaned traces. The release manager signs off only after three consecutive clean trace runs. Once verified, unseal the ceremony envelope using the passphrase recorded below.

vault phrase of bagaf-kajeg = jorath-feniel-briir-siliel-ralix

Subject: Quickstore 4.2 — bloom filter now fronts the KV layer

Plugin authors: starting with this release, Quickstore places a bloom filter ahead of the key-value store. Negative lookups return faster; false positives fall through safely. No API changes are required on your side. Verify your plugin against the staging build referenced below.

session token of fahif-tadup = htk3_9c7

// REINDEX_BATCH_CAP limits docs per shard pass in the Tallowfield
// nightly search reindex. Raising it starves the ingest queue;
// lowering it overruns the maintenance window. 5000 is the tested
// sweet spot. Change only with a soak run. Verified against the
// build noted below.

session token of bawif-hahog = htk6_ac5981